Tips for Using Your Loaf Pan with Lid

  1. Preparation is Key

    • Grease the pan lightly, even with the non-stick coating, to ensure effortless bread release.
    • Preheat your oven to the recommended temperature for your recipe.
  2. Perfect Dough Placement

    • Place the dough evenly in the pan to ensure it rises uniformly.
    • For best results, allow the dough to rise in the pan with the lid on before baking.
  3. Baking with the Lid On

    • Baking with the lid on traps steam, creating a soft, tender crumb.
    • Remove the lid towards the end of baking to achieve a golden, crispy crust.
  4. Cooling and Removing the Bread

    • Allow the bread to cool in the pan for a few minutes before removing it.
    • Use a spatula to gently loosen the sides if needed, then turn the pan over to release the loaf.
